In 'The Complete Works' of Sir James Matthew Barrie, the pages teem with the fantastical and wholly imaginative landscapes that have enchanted readers for over a century. Among these cherished works, Barrie's immortal creation, Peter Pan, stands paramount, exploring the eternal allure of perpetual childhood against the relentless march of time. As a consummate collection, this tome showcases Barrie's literary prowess through a diversity of formsplaywrighting, novel writing, and the craft of short storieswhile delving into themes of reality versus illusion, the nature of ambition, and the poignant beauty of fleeting innocence. The compilation not only includes the well-beloved adventures of the boy who wouldn't grow up but also presents a wider literary context with Barrie's lesser-known yet equally poignant essays, plays, and memoirs. The synthesis of whimsy and deeper social observations throughout Barrie's oeuvre demonstrates an intriguing interplay between Edwardian societal norms and imaginative escapism. Sir James Matthew Barrie's life and career provide an insightful backdrop to 'The Complete Works.' Born in the small weaving town of Kirriemuir, Scotland, Barrie's literary voice was shaped by his early experiences and his inexhaustible imagination. His emotional depth can be seen as a response to his own personal losses and his observations of the Victorian and Edwardian eras' social complexities. With accomplishments spanning from journalist to dramatist, Barrie's experiences infused his writing with a unique blend of melancholy, humor, and wit. The pathos found in 'The Little Minister' and 'Sentimental Tommy,' reveal more than mere tales; they reflect a profound understanding of human nature and a subtle critique of social mores.
